Scrounger / ioBroker.linkeddevices

Create linked objects (datapoints) of your devices with a self-defined structure. This makes it possible to create a structure in ioBroker, where all objects are centralized, e.g. to be used in the vis or scripts.
https://forum.iobroker.net/topic/22301/neuer-adapter-linkeddevices
MIT License
17 stars 11 forks source link

Unterstrukturen beim Anlegen von linked objects werden nicht umgesetzt #91

Open rokra57 opened 3 months ago

rokra57 commented 3 months ago

beim Anlegen von verlinkten Objekten wird der prefix ignoriert. Ein Erstellen von Objekten mit Verlinkung auf Unterstrukturen im Hauptpfad "linkeddevices.0" ist nicht mehr möglich. Der Fehler tritt auf mit Update auf den neuen Admin-Adapter 6.17.14... mit der bisherigen Version 6.13.16 funktioniert noch alles korrekt. Bereits bestehende links funktionieren noch und werden auch in der Übersicht korrekt angezeigt.

Beispiel: neuer link auf Zielpfad "linkeddevices.0.test.device" image Ergebnis: image

image

Versions: admin v6.17.14 linkeddevices v1.5.5 js-controller 5.0.19 node v20.14.0 OS: debian11, running in promox LX-Container

softwarecrash commented 3 months ago

kann ich leider bestätigen. ich gehe mitlerweile davon aus das der adapter einfach tot ist da es gut zwei jahre her ist das etwas geändert wurde und das letzte release 4 jahre... eine brauchbare alternative hab ich aber auch noch nicht

gemsli commented 3 months ago

Ich hoffe inständig, dass du falsch liegst, denn alle meine Skripte beruhen auf der inzwischen sehr gewachsenen linkeddevices Struktur. Ohne passende Alternative ist iobroker nur eingeschränkt zu benutzen, wenn man an verschiedenen Stellen im Haus hin und wieder Geräte wechselt.

softwarecrash commented 3 months ago

Ich hoffe inständig, dass du falsch liegst, denn alle meine Skripte beruhen auf der inzwischen sehr gewachsenen linkeddevices Struktur. Ohne passende Alternative ist iobroker nur eingeschränkt zu benutzen, wenn man an verschiedenen Stellen im Haus hin und wieder Geräte wechselt.

Ich vermute mal es soll ein Versuch sein mit devices die Funktionen vom linkeddevices zu übernehmen, aber das Teil hab ich auch noch nicht verstanden und es schränkt doch arg ein.

rokra57 commented 3 months ago

Nachdem ich noch etwas Zeit in weitere Recherchen investiert habe, bin ich ebenfalls der Überzeugung, dass der Adapter nicht mehr weiterentwickelt wird. Für mich etwas unverständlich, dass es im Repository keinerlei Hinweise darauf gibt. Ich habe mich deshalb inzwischen entschieden auf den Alias-adapter umzusteigen. Bei über 450 linkeddevices-objekten bedeutet das ein mehrtägiges manuelles umarbeiten, aber danach ist man ja wieder "zukunftsfähig" :-)

softwarecrash commented 2 months ago

Nachdem ich noch etwas Zeit in weitere Recherchen investiert habe, bin ich ebenfalls der Überzeugung, dass der Adapter nicht mehr weiterentwickelt wird. Für mich etwas unverständlich, dass es im Repository keinerlei Hinweise darauf gibt. Ich habe mich deshalb inzwischen entschieden auf den Alias-adapter umzusteigen. Bei über 450 linkeddevices-objekten bedeutet das ein mehrtägiges manuelles umarbeiten, aber danach ist man ja wieder "zukunftsfähig" :-)

hast da irgend ne anleitung oder sowas, hab mal grad reingeschaut, mit alias manager, ich check da rein garnichts.

gemsli commented 2 months ago

Vielleicht hat @Scrounger ja auch noch eine Idee, wie man das Problem beheben kann oder überhaupt Lust sich dieses Meisterwerks noch einmal anzunehmen. Wenn man seine gesamten Geräte im Haus in einer eigenen Struktur mit linkeddevices zusammengefasst hat, wäre der Verlust dieses Adapters sehr schmerzhaft.

bungee71 commented 2 months ago

Ich bin am gleichen Punkt, neue Tags werden nur noch im root verzeichnis des Adapter angelegt, bei eingabe eines Präfix erkennt er immer üngültige Zeichen obwohl dies nicht der Fall ist. Es wäre echt schade, wenn @Scrounger diesen Adapter nicht weiter pflegen würde - vielleicht nimmt sich ja auch jemand anderes von den Entwickler dem Adapter an.

urdl commented 1 month ago

hier ein anderer Issue zum selben Problem: https://github.com/Scrounger/ioBroker.linkeddevices/issues/89#issuecomment-2308752481

L-C-P commented 1 month ago

Ich habe einen Workaround für das Problem erstellt: https://github.com/Scrounger/ioBroker.linkeddevices/issues/89#issuecomment-2367976332